SSC Service Utility not working with R1800

SSC Service Utility not working with R1800

2007-10-11 by the_des_bois

Steven's comments brought to my attention the existence of the  SSC
Service Utility.

I downloaded the last version, installed on XP Pro SP2. It will not
communicate correctly with the R1800. No ink levels show. It prints a
blank nozzle pattern test page. So it recognizes the printer but there
seem to be some conflicts somewhere.

As for carts, I have MIS half-sponge in there. 

Could it be a conflict with the Epson Status Monitor? I checked the
option to disable it, restarted the computer, with printer on and
printer off but to no avail. The Epson Satus Monitor is always on.

Does one have to uninstall the Epson printer software to disable the
Epson Status Monitor? Or is there a simpler way to disable it?

Anyone had this problem and solved it?

Re: SSC Service Utility not working with R1800

2007-10-11 by Steven Karafyllakis

Hi Dennis;

I have used the SSC to reset the wastetank cou nter on the R1800, 
never had any trouble like that with it. Is the 5.0 version out? 
maybe its 'buggy' if that's the case. My comment was actually 
refering to the Epson adjustment program that techs use when 
replacing heads, etc. It is available on 2manuals,com. Fair warning-
it seems to have much greater potential for getting into trouble.
